Fernmeldeturm Mannheim

The Fernmeldeturm Mannheim is a 204.8 metre high concrete telecommunication tower with an observation deck at Mannheim. It was designed from the architects Heinle, Wischer und Partner and constructed between 1973 and 1975. This modern monument of Mannheim contains besides transmission facilities for UHR radio services and omnidirectional radio services a glassed observation deck and a rotating restaurant in a height of 120 metres, which allows a nice view over Mannheim and the surrounding area.

In December 1994 a helicopter of the Army collided with the top of the tower and fell to ground. All four people in the helicopter died. At this accident parts of the top of the tower were damaged and fell to ground.

Geographical coordinates: [49°29′16″N, 8°29′36″E].
